| What It Does | Builderkit offers a complete, production-ready Next.js 14 codebase integrated with crucial services for building AI SaaS applications. It handles foundational elements such as user authentication via NextAuth.js, subscription management through Stripe, database integration with Drizzle ORM and PostgreSQL, and seamless API calls to OpenAI. This allows users to focus solely on developing their unique AI features and business logic, rather than constructing the underlying infrastructure from scratch. | This AI tool connects directly to a user's GitHub account, allowing them to select specific repositories for analysis. It then processes the codebase to build a comprehensive understanding, enabling users to ask natural language questions and receive instant, accurate answers about code logic, structure, and functionality. Concurrently, it provides AI-powered feedback on pull requests, identifying potential issues and suggesting improvements before human reviewers intervene. |
